For the most part, a rotten motor home flooring suggests a water leakage somewhere in the roofing system or wall surfaces, it might also be created by a leakage in the recreational vehicle's pipes. Evaluate the rotten area closely. Inspect close-by walls, home windows, the roof covering above, and any water lines or drainpipe pipes in the location.
When you've located every one of the soft areas, cut and peel back the laminate or carpeting to reveal the rotten subfloor. Some individuals select to do this action extremely carefully, cutting along the wall, so they are able to make use of the same floor covering after the repair services are made. No matter just how you tackle it, maintain peeling off the floor covering back in all instructions from the soft area until you locate great, strong timber that is not blemished on all four sides.
This can be done using a tiny saw to reduce up the subfloor and a pry bar to dig the wood out. If there is foam under your subfloor, take care to eliminate the timber, however not the foam. If there are wood supports under your subfloor, you will wish to get rid of adequate wood that you meet supports on at the very least 2 sides and afterwards reduced the hole to be a straight-sided rectangle to make things later when adding new timber.
You do not desire any type of broken timber staying, as this can really cause the new timber to start to rot all over again. As soon as the damaged subfloor is gone, let any type of subjected timber framework and the timber around the soft area completely dry out entirely. This could take a week or even more, yet it will certainly assist to ensure you will not experience the exact very same problem when you finish the RV floor replacement.
